Taking everything into account, FORM scores 5 out of 10 in our fundamental rating. FORM was compared to 113 industry peers in the Semiconductors & Semiconductor Equipment industry. While FORM has a great health rating, its profitability is only average at the moment. FORM is quite expensive at the moment. It does show a decent growth rate.

1. Profitability

1.1 Basic Checks

  • FORM had positive earnings in the past year.
  • In the past year FORM had a positive cash flow from operations.
  • Each year in the past 5 years FORM has been profitable.
  • Each year in the past 5 years FORM had a positive operating cash flow.

1.2 Ratios

  • Looking at the Return On Assets, with a value of 4.44%, FORM is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 64.60% of the companies in the same industry.
  • With a Return On Equity value of 5.25%, FORM perfoms like the industry average, outperforming 58.41% of the companies in the same industry.
  • FORM has a Return On Invested Capital of 4.58%. This is in the better half of the industry: FORM outperforms 61.06% of its industry peers.
  • FORM had an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years of 3.10%. This is significantly below the industry average of 10.76%.
  • The 3 year average ROIC (3.10%) for FORM is below the current ROIC(4.58%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

1.3 Margins

  • FORM has a Profit Margin of 6.93%. This is comparable to the rest of the industry: FORM outperforms 59.29% of its industry peers.
  • In the last couple of years the Profit Margin of FORM has declined.
  • Looking at the Operating Margin, with a value of 7.61%, FORM is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 60.18% of the companies in the same industry.
  • FORM's Operating Margin has declined in the last couple of years.
  • FORM has a Gross Margin (39.34%) which is comparable to the rest of the industry.
  • FORM's Gross Margin has been stable in the last couple of years.

2. Health

2.1 Basic Checks

  • FORM has a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C), which is below the Cost of Capital (WACC), which means it is destroying value.
  • FORM has more shares outstanding than it did 1 year ago.
  • Compared to 5 years ago, FORM has about the same amount of shares outstanding.
  • Compared to 1 year ago, FORM has an improved debt to assets ratio.

2.2 Solvency

  • FORM has an Altman-Z score of 24.39. This indicates that FORM is financially healthy and has little risk of bankruptcy at the moment.
  •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 24.39, FORM bel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 89.38% of the companies in the same industry.
  • FORM has a debt to FCF ratio of 1.04. This is a very positive value and a sign of high solvency as it would only need 1.04 years to pay back of all of its debts.
  • FORM has a better Debt to FCF ratio (1.04) than 73.45% of its industry peers.
  • FORM has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.01. This is a healthy value indicating a solid balance between debt and equity.
  •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 0.01, FORM is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 69.91% of the companies in the same industry.

2.3 Liquidity

  • A Current Ratio of 4.50 indicates that FORM has no problem at all paying its short term obligations.
  • FORM's Current ratio of 4.50 is fine compared to the rest of the industry. FORM outperforms 67.26% of its industry peers.
  • FORM has a Quick Ratio of 3.60. This indicates that FORM is financially healthy and has no problem in meeting its short term obligations.
  • With a decent Quick ratio value of 3.60, FORM is doing good in the industry, outperforming 68.14% of the companies in the same industry.

3. Growth

3.1 Past

  • FORM shows a strong growth in Earnings Per Share. In the last year, the EPS has been growing by 12.17%, which is quite good.
  • The Earnings Per Share has been decreasing by -2.84% on average over the past years.
  • Looking at the last year, FORM shows a small growth in Revenue. The Revenue has grown by 2.80% in the last year.
  • The Revenue has been growing slightly by 2.51% on average over the past years.

4. Valuation

4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io

  • With a Price/Earnings ratio of 74.47, FORM can be considered very expensive at the moment.
  • The rest of the industry has a similar Price/Earnings ratio as FORM.
  • FORM's Price/Earnings ratio indicates a rather expensive valuation when compared to the S&P500 average which is at 28.23.
  •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 59.27, the valuation of FORM can be described as expensive.
  • FORM's Price/Forward Earnings ratio is in line with the industry average.
  • FORM is valuated expensively when we compare the Price/Forward Earnings ratio to 28.01, which is the current average of the S&P500 Index.
